Q: Is 24,746,745 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 24,746,745 is a composite number.

Why is 24,746,745 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 24,746,745 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 1,649,783 4,949,349 8,248,915 and 24,746,745, with no remainder.

Since 24,746,745 cannot be divided by just 1 and 24,746,745, it is a composite number.
